Our Board
The Sparkle Strong Foundation is led by a team of advocates, educators, and caregivers who’ve each spent years in service-oriented work, and we bring that same energy, heart, and fight to CHD families. From social justice to school leadership, military life to medical parenting, every voice at this table brings something fierce, thoughtful, and real. We’re not here to just talk about change, we’re here to build it, one heartbeat, one family, one sparkling step at a time.
Jessica Ma’ilo, M. Ed.
Founder + President
Jessica created Sparkle Strong Foundation to stand in the gap for families navigating the chaos of congenital heart defects especially those who don’t speak “medical,” don’t have a partner at their side or don’t see themselves reflected in traditional support systems. A former teacher, single mom and foster parent to a medically complex heart warrior, Jessica brings fierce advocacy, boundless creativity and hard-earned wisdom to everything Sparkle Strong does. Her deep understanding of life inside the CICU, equal parts heartbreak and hope, drives the Foundation’s focus on practical support, emotional validation and real joy in impossible places. When she’s not building resources or dreaming up new programs, Jessica spends her days remembering her sweet Jewels, plans magical vacations for families and continues believing that one mom with fire in her chest can change the world—or at the very least, light it up a little.
Keri Spinks-Bates, Ed. D.
Vice President
Keri Spinks-Bates is a veteran educator and current high school principal with nearly 20 years of experience serving Oklahoma students and families. She brings strategic leadership and a deep commitment to equity and advocacy to the Sparkle Strong board. Her connection to the mission is personal—when Jessica needed support for her child, Keri showed up without hesitation. That moment solidified her dedication to families navigating complex medical journeys. In addition to her educational expertise, Keri brings heart, humor, and a lifelong love of Disney—believing that joy, magic, and human connection are vital parts of healing and hope.
Melanie Kelley, Ed. D.
Secretary
Melanie Kelley is a strategic and mission-driven educational leader with nearly a decade of experience supporting diverse students, educators and families across K–12 systems. With expertise in instructional design, educator coaching and inclusive school climate initiatives, she is deeply committed to equity-centered, trauma-informed approaches that foster student success and community connection. Currently serving as a Coordinator in the Office of a Pedagogy of Hope at Gonzaga University, she also leads with heart in her local community as a Girl Scout Troop Leader with the Eastern Washington Northern Idaho Girl Scout Council and as the Social Media Coordinator for the Finch Elementary PTO. As a Sparkle Strong board member, she is honored to champion families impacted by CHD by amplifying hope, dignity and belonging for every child and caregiver.
Tracy Poolaw Ma’ilo, MSW
Treasurer
Tracy Poolaw Ma’ilo is a lifelong helper, advocate, and behind-the-scenes powerhouse, both in her professional life and as “GamGam” to her fiercely loved grandbabies. Her career has spanned youth services, tribal programs and elder care, including her most recent role with the Advantage Program supporting low-income seniors. She’s worked with organizations like the Oklahoma City Indian Clinic, Delaware Nation Vocational Rehabilitation and Aging Services, always bringing resourcefulness, empathy and a deep understanding of community needs. When Jewels entered the family, Tracy went all in earning her medical grandma badge by supporting heart clinic visits, learning meds and stepping in wherever needed. In retirement, she delivers flowers, loves a good festival and never misses a chance to say yes to grandkid phone time (and funnel cake). She is proud to continue Jewels’s legacy through Sparkle Strong.
Michelle Schneider
Board Member
Michelle Schneider is a dedicated mother, operations leader and passionate advocate for children and families affected by congenital heart disease. Inspired by her niece Jewels’s courageous battle and the legacy of her own mother, who also faced and lost her battle with heart failure, Michelle proudly serves on the board of the Sparkle Strong Foundation. She brings over a decade of experience in operational excellence, helping organizations grow while keeping people at the center. Michelle’s commitment to the foundation is deeply personal, and she channels her energy into raising awareness, supporting families and helping Sparkle Strong continue its vital mission of hope, education, and community.
